June 25, 2013- Stocks Remain Positive and Look to Break Trend Resistance

After moving sharply higher in early trading, stocks have remained mostly positive over the course of the trading day on Tuesday. The strong gains on the day are partly offsetting the steep losses posted over the past few sessions. While the major averages have not seen much follow-through on their initial upward move, they remain firmly positive. The Dow is up 114.11 points or 0.8 percent at 14,773.67, the Nasdaq is up 24.00 points or 0.7 percent at 3,344.76 and the S&P 500 is up 14.54 points or 0.9 percent at 1,587.63. The strength on Wall Street comes as some traders have gone bargain hunting following the recent weakness in the markets, which pulled the major averages down to two-month closing lows. Traders are also digesting a batch of largely upbeat U.S. economic news, including a report from the Commerce Department showing a bigger than expected increase in durable goods orders in May.
